Excellent Business Plan

Publisher Hoepli, 2021, Italy – 7th Edition

Born in 1999 as IL BUSINESS PLAN, the book has been written during a work experience in the USA, where the academic background of the author merged with the ongoing business requirements of his American start-up. Over 20 years, the book, translated into Spanish and sold in Latin America and Spain in its second edition, has evolved along with the practical cases provided by the planning and development of hundreds of start-ups and companies in multiple industries. In recent times, the author, after careful study of the Lean movement and its comparison with the Traditional planning approach, theorized a third approach able to conjugate the two doctrines, expressed by a new model, the Complete Lean Investment Planning, or CLIP. On the basis of his new theory, he then writes the LEAN BUSINESS PLAN, and after, merges the 6th edition of its Business Plan best-seller into this new book, the advanced version of the LEAN BUSINESS PLAN becoming the PRO edition.

Excellent business plan

This PRO book adds to the LEAN more business insights in terms of management and planning, introducing as well the topic of the Strategic Performance Assessment, three additional chapters, and a second business case to the first one illustrated in the simpler edition.

The PRO edition is not necessarily better than the LEAN one, sharing the same fundamentals and planning theory: the simpler edition is best guide for start-ups and small companies in setting up their growth roadmap. The advanced book is more oriented to a professional audience, and suitable to support the planning needs of more complex organizations: university professors, students, managers of larger organizations.

Lean business plan

Publisher Hoepli, 2020, Italy.

Lean Business Plan is tackling the conflicting opposition between the Traditional approach to business planning with the newest planning doctrine proposed by the Lean movement. The book assesses the pros and cons of both approaches, merging the best benefits coming from the opposite theories. Upon the author's findings, the best is a way to combine an experimenting activity throughout a more extended planning phase, throughout the application of a new approach summarized by the CLIP, the Complete Lean Investment Planning model, comprehensively described in the text.

The corporate strategy map

McGraw-Hill Italia, Milan, June 2008

Corporate strategy is an ongoing matter always under the lights of managers and entrepreneurs, along with researchers willing to contribute with their insights. In the last thirty years, many new theories emerged, creating models able to classify and interpret either the context (industries, markets) or the actors (competitors, clients, suppliers, lenders, etc.), with the common purpose to isolate factors and cause-effects relationships adequate to guarantee the social and economic success of companies. The text originates from the study of different theories on business strategy, an investigation that ends with the construction of the Integrated Strategy Model (Modello del Quadro Strategico Integrato). This model gives an overview on the cause-effects relations among business factors contained in some of the most known corporate strategies, adding original observations and theory insights enabling to reach an organic overview of the matter. The text is addressed to managers and entrepreneurs willing to handle a Model enabling them to shape successfully their corporate strategies in the increasing complexity of all business markets.

El Plan de Negocios

McGraw-Hill Colombia, Santa Fè de Bogotà, May 2000

The author describes his business planning activity during his US entrepreneurial experience, from what he conceived the idea to write a book:" ...after time spent gaining comprehension of the American business culture, elements necessary for proper planning were gathered. After collecting a sufficient amount of data, I began to draw the first economic and financial forecasts. I worked closely with an advisor from the SBA Small Business Development at Austin, where I learned theoretical financial differences in the U.S. approach in comparison with European methods. This period brought me a great opportunity to assimilate the American way of business planning, in some manners so similar and in others so different from the approach learned in my country. I adapted my original plan to integrate what I had learned of the U.S. business environment... at this point, I had the idea to summarize my whole experience in a book.... "
